软件项目配置管理:概念、组织与功能详解
第六章的主题是"软件项目配置管理",这是IT项目管理中的关键环节。本章主要涵盖了以下几个核心知识点: 1. **配置管理概念**:首先介绍了配置管理的基本概念,它是指在软件开发过程中对所有相关产品、过程和活动的文档、数据和信息进行有组织的控制,以确保它们的正确性、完整性和一致性。配置管理有助于跟踪和控制项目的各个阶段,确保每个阶段的产品都符合预定的需求。 2. **配置管理组织和职责**:讲解了配置管理团队的角色和职责,包括配置管理员、配置审计员、变更控制委员会等角色在项目中的具体任务,以及如何建立一个有效的配置管理系统。 3. **配置管理功能**:详细阐述了配置管理的功能,如版本控制、变更管理、配置状态记录、配置审计等,这些都是确保项目顺利进行的基础工具和技术。 4. **配置管理计划**:涉及制定配置管理计划的过程,这包括确定配置管理的目标、策略、方法、工具和流程,以及如何在整个项目生命周期中执行和维护这些计划。 5. **基于构件的配置管理**:探讨了现代软件开发中越来越流行的基于构件的方法,如何通过复用和管理可重用组件来优化配置管理,提高开发效率和产品质量。 章节中还穿插了**可行性研究报告**的部分,强调了在软件项目开始前进行详细的研究,评估项目的可行性,包括技术可行性、经济可行性和时间可行性。这个阶段会涉及多个步骤,如需求分析、成本估算、时间表规划等,最终确定最佳方案并制定初步的计划和预算。 此外,章节还讨论了**需求规格说明书**的重要性,它是软件开发过程中的基础文档,详细记录了用户对系统或产品的期望,配置管理必须确保这些规格的一致性和完整性。 第六章深入剖析了软件项目配置管理的各个方面,从理论到实践,对于项目管理者和开发者来说,理解和掌握这些知识至关重要,可以帮助他们更好地控制项目进度,保证产品质量,并降低潜在的风险。
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/release/wenkucmsfe/public/img/green-success.6a4acb44.png)